You configure an alert to send you an email when you have a high CPU load on your devices. Your NPM web console shows several devices have high CPU utilization, but you have not received any emails. What could be the issue?

One possible reason why you have not received any emails for the high CPU load alert is that the alerts are muted on the devices. Muting alerts means that the alert conditions are still evaluated, but the alert actions are not executed. This can be useful when you want to temporarily suppress notifications for planned maintenance or testing. You can mute alerts for individual nodes, groups, or applications, or for all alerts in the Orion Platform. To check if the alerts are muted on the devices, you can go to the Manage Nodes page and look for the Muted column. You can also use the Mute Alerts widget on the Orion homepage to see the status of alert muting. To unmute alerts, you can either use the same widget or the Unmute Alerts option in the node, group, or application details page. References: Mute alerts, Manage nodes, Mute Alerts widget
